Currently only used for assigning an audio channel talk role (once) for all users. Should moderators remove the permission, then it will not be reassigned by the bot.

The documentation at https://discord.js.org is partially ok, at least for class attributes, but at least some of the method signatures listed there are simply incorrect/out-of-date. The best place to check method signatures is to read the TypeScript declarations from node_modules/discord.js/typings/index.d.ts
after running npm install
.
